ENGIE closes agreement with VESTAS to implement largest wind project in Latin America

  ENGIE closes agreement with VESTAS to implement largest wind project in Latin America The firm order includes the initial supply, installation, operation and maintenance of 120 V150 – 4.5 MW turbines for the 540 MW first phase of Serra de Assuruá. In addition to phase 1, the contract includes the option for ENGIE to purchase another 68 units by the end of 2022 for phase two of the wind park. Vestas will also deliver a 25 year active output management 5000 (AOM 5000) service agreement. This agreement will optimise energy production while also providing long-term business case certainty. Source: Energy Global Engie Brasil Energia SA has signed an agreement with Vestas for the Serra de Assuruá wind park in the state of Bahia, in the municipality of Gentio do Ouro, Brazil. The project has a total nameplate capacity of 846 MW once fully installed, making it the largest wind project in Latin America. In Latin America Nubank Gains 70 Million Customers

  In Latin America Nubank Gains 70 Million Customers In Brazil, Nubank continues to grow on other business fronts, such as investments, where it already has more than 6 million active customers, with emphasis on its fund management arm, Nu Asset Management. Source: EFT TRENDS Nubank is seeing meteoric growth and is continuing to expand. The São Paulo-based digital bank has garnered 70 million customers in Latin America, making it the fifth-largest financial institution in Brazil in terms of number of customers. This includes 66.4 million users in the Brazilian operation, 3.2 million in Mexico, and more than 400,000 in Colombia. “Our accelerated growth is driven by an ongoing search for efficiency, which balances expansion, new products, and increased revenue per customer,” said Nubank founder and CEO David Vélez in an announcement from the company. Google invests in embedded lending fintech R2 from Latin America

  Google invests in embedded lending fintech R2 from Latin America Latin American embedded lending fintech R2 has raised US$15mn in a Series A funding round led by Google’s AI-focused venture fund, Gradient Ventures, just seven months after completing a seed round. Source: Fintech Magazine R2, an embedded lending fintech from Latin America, has received US$15mn of Series A investment led by the AI-focused venture fund of search giant Google. The Mexico City-based startup offers a white-label solution that allows brands to easily embed lending experiences into their digital platforms using R2’s APIs. Over the past year, the fintech has partnered with some of the region’s largest technology platforms, financed over 3,000 small businesses and grown monthly revenue by a factor of more than 20.
